How to prepare for a job interview at Connex Education

✨Show Your Passion for Child Development

During the interview, express your genuine enthusiasm for working with children. Share specific examples of how you've fostered child development in previous roles or experiences, as this aligns perfectly with the nursery's mission.

✨Demonstrate Your EYFS Knowledge

Be prepared to discuss the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) framework. Highlight your understanding of its principles and how you can implement them in a nursery setting to support children's learning and development.

✨Highlight Your Communication Skills

Effective communication is key in a nursery environment. Provide examples of how you've successfully communicated with children, parents, and colleagues in the past, showcasing your ability to build strong relationships.

✨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ills and ability to handle challenging situations with children. Think of examples from your experience where you successfully managed such scenarios and be ready to share them.
